The second auction of the Karnataka Premier League for season II was held at the Chinnaswamy stadium Bangalore on a low-on-energy atmosphere with only nine players attracting bids from franchises.
Former India seamer David Johnson, a key player for last year’s runner-up Belgaum Panthers, was recently seen hobnobbing with Bijapur Bulls in a clear violation of team ethics.
Players purchased by Belgaum Panthers: C.K. Akshay (Belagavi Panthers), Rs. 45,000; Akshay is a utility all-rounder, who can bat well down the order and chip in with accurate off-spin.

Provident Bangalore won the first KPL trophy by beating Belgaum Panthers by 5 wickets.
Batting first Belgaum Panthers scored 122 for 7 in the 20 overs. Provident Bangalore scored 125 for 5 with 4 balls to spare.

In scintillating semi finals the Belgaum Panthers won by 15 runs against the Bangalore Brigadiers.
The finals will be played tomorrow i.e. 23 at 7.30 pm at Chinnaswamy stadium. The other finalist will be the winner of the second semi final between Provident Bangalore v Bijapur Bulls.
Belagavi Panthers socred 159/7 in 20 overs where as the Bangalore Brigadiers managed only 144/10 in 20 ovs.

Belgaum is famous for Kunda and the border row and the dispute keeps peeping itself in on various occasions, thanks to some pro language people and organizations.
This time the row is over the naming of the KPL franchisee as Belagavi Panthers. Advocate Madhav Chavan, in a letter has written to former BCCI president and Union Minister for Agriculture Sharad Pawar urging action against Karnataka State Cricket Association for naming the cricket team “Belagavi Panthers”. He also stated that the central government had not given its nod for renaming of Belgaum and when the official name is still Belgaum why the team name has been kept as Belagavi.
Mr.Chavan also mentioned that that neither government nor the association had the right to use the name “Belagavi”, as long as the matter was still in court.
May what happen but the language bias does come up in some form or the other in Belgaum. The idea of Mr.Chavan of writing to Shard Pawar may not do any good.
Now let us think of a hypothetical situation where in the team name is changed to Belgaum Panthers, then what happens, the Pro Kannada organizations will come up strongly against the changing of the name.
A notable factor here is the names of other teams of the KPL. Bangalore Brigadiers why wasn’t it named as ‘Bengaluru’ Brigadiers or Mysore Maharaajas as ‘Mysuru’ Maharaajas.
